What is a Registered Agent?
A designated representative is an entity or business entity chosen to accept official documents and official communications on behalf of a company. This includes crucial documents such as legal notices, financial filings, and compliance-related correspondence. Having a registered agent is a mandatory obligation for most companies, including limited liability companies and corporate entities, in order to ensure that there is a consistent means to contact the organization regarding law-related concerns.
When a company assigns a registered agent, it provides a shield of privacy for the stakeholders and guarantees that they do not have to be available to the public to accept court notices. A registered agent must have a physical address in the state where the business is formed, known as the designated address. This location is where all legal notices will be sent and should be manned during regular business hours.
Registered agents can be persons or licensed professionals, often referred to as registered agent services. Registered Agent Compliance
All business entity, including an LLC or corporation, is mandated to designate a registered agent to comply with state regulations. This individual or service acts as the official point of contact for legal documents, ensuring that the business remains informed about all legal actions or compliance requirements. Appointing a registered agent is not just a formality; it is a mandatory requirement that helps shield the business from potential penalties and ensures timely communication regarding critical matters.
The legal requirements surrounding registered agents can differ from jurisdiction to state. Typically, a registered agent must have a physical address within the state where the business is registered, and they must be available during typical business hours to receive service of process. Businesses can choose to hire a professional registered agent service, which can simplify compliance with these legal obligations and provide expertise in navigating the requirements of different jurisdictions.
Failure to maintain a compliant registered agent can lead to serious repercussions, such as loss of good standing, fines, or even the closure of the business.
